About

Come see for yourself, this unique tri-plex at the historic Pythian building in the heart of the Upper West Side by Lincoln Square.

The apartment has a powder room as you enter, staircase to the upper level, a full kitchen behind a pair of pocket doors, a dining area, sunken living room and two large windows facing North. Upstairs is the large bedroom, with a covered patio and a walkway to the full bathroom with a tub and a dressing area with a wall of closets.

Named after and defined by the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ts, Lincoln Square is home to the New York Philharmonic, the New York City Ballet and the Metropolitan Opera, among many other cultural institutions. The neighborhood blends the prewar architecture and and style of the Upper West Side with modern, tall residential buildings. Great subway access at Columbus Circle and proximity to Midtown make this neighborhood popular with those looking to be in the center of it all.
